### 了解比特币钱包
首先,聊聊比特币钱包是什么。简单来说,比特币钱包就像你的银行账户,但它不在银行里,而是在互联网的某个地方。这意味着你可以很方便地发送、接收比特币,以及查看你的余额。钱包主要分为热钱包和冷钱包。热钱包在线上,而冷钱包离线,后者更安全,但不太方便。
在Linux下配置比特币钱包其实相对简单。我们可以用比较流行的比特币核心钱包(Bitcoin Core)来做示范。
### 准备工作
在动手之前,先确保你的Linux系统是最新的。打开终端,看一下你的版本:
```bash
uname -a
```
确保这个版本能支持比特币核心钱包。一般来说,你需要一个稳定的64位系统,比如Ubuntu 20.04或更高版本。再来看看硬盘空间,这个钱包需要不少空间(现在大约350GB),足够的空间可以避免后期麻烦。
### 下载比特币核心钱包
你可以通过官方网站下载比特币核心钱包。打开终端输入以下命令:
```bash
wget https://bitcoincore.org/bin/bitcoin-core-x.x.x/bitcoin-x.x.x-x86_64-linux-gnu.tar.gz
```
记得把“x.x.x”替换成最新版本号哦!下载完成后,解压缩文件:
```bash
tar -xzvf bitcoin-x.x.x-x86_64-linux-gnu.tar.gz
```
然后你会看到一个刚解压的文件夹,进入这个文件夹:
```bash
cd bitcoin-x.x.x/bin
```
在这里你会找到`bitcoind`和`bitcoin-cli`两个文件,它们是我们后面要使用的。
### 安装比特币核心钱包
接下来,我们需要把这两个可执行文件放在一个系统的PATH中。你可以选择使用`sudo`来安装它们,输入:
```bash
sudo cp bitcoind bitcoin-cli /usr/local/bin/
```
这样,你就可以在任何地方调用它们了。
### 配置钱包
在运行比特币核心钱包之前,我们需要先对其进行配置。在用户目录下创建一个名为`.bitcoin`的文件夹,并进入这个文件夹:
```bash
mkdir ~/.bitcoin
cd ~/.bitcoin
```
然后创建一个配置文件`bitcoin.conf`。你可以使用`nano`或`vim`等文本编辑器来创建和编辑这个文件:
```bash
nano bitcoin.conf
```
在这个文件中,你可以设置一些基本参数,比如:
```
server=1
daemon=1
txindex=1
rpcuser=你的用户名
rpcpassword=你的密码
```
记得将“你的用户名”和“你的密码”换成自己想要的内容。这样做的目的是为了后面通过RPC远程调用,安全第一嘛。
### 启动钱包
配置完成后,你就可以启动比特币核心钱包了:
```bash
bitcoind
```
这时候,钱包会开始同步区块链历史。这可不是一两分钟能完成的事情,耐心等待吧!你可以新开一个终端窗口,试试是不是已经成功运行:
```bash
bitcoin-cli getblockchaininfo
```
如果一切顺利,成功的信息会显示在你的终端里,标志着你已经成功配置了比特币钱包!
### 再来一点小技巧
1. **备份钱包**:虽然比特币钱包有很强的安全性,但万一发生什么事情,记得及时备份。钱包文件通常位于`~/.bitcoin/wallets/`文件夹中。
2. **检查钱包状态**:随时可以用以下命令查看钱包状态:
```bash
bitcoin-cli getwalletinfo
```
3. **安全性**:对于远程访问(RPC部分),您可能需要考虑额外的安全措施,如使用SSL连接或VPN。
### 结语
总的来说,在Linux下配置比特币钱包并不是一件特别复杂的事情,只要按照步骤来,基本上都能顺利完成。不过在后续的操作中,最好能够多关注官方文档,随着比特币生态的发展,钱包软件也在不断更新,跟上趋势总是对的。
如果你有什么问题或者遇到困难,欢迎随时交流!希望你能在比特币的世界里找到乐趣和价值!
